> By the way, do you plan to support incremental IMAP fetch somehow? I
> sort of have the crazy desire to use Turnsole on a day to day basis.
It's possible. The best way to use heliotrope is probably with a
.procmailrc, but I realize many people have IMAP access to their primary
account and being able to incrementally import from that would be ideal.
IMAP doesn't appear to have very good support for this type of thing,
though, so I'm not 100% sure how to do it yet.
